It might seem like it sometimes, but there's no secret handshake required to join staff. You don't have to know someone, or be invited, or anything else. All you have to do is want to help. :) And as Kumoricon keeps growing, we'll need that help more and more.

If you have a question that isn't answered below, please feel free to ask and we'll get an answer for you.

2) Will I be able to go to my favorite panels or events?

It depends a lot on your position(s), but generally the answer is "Yes". Some positions do most or all of their work before the convention, for example. Most positions are primarily at-con work, but your manager or Director will do their best to schedule you so that you don't have to miss out. The con is supposed to be fun for staff too, after all.

3) But I've heard a lot of stories about staffers who hardly have time to sleep, let alone anything else. Are you sure I'll have free time?

A lot of our staff are hardcore workaholics. You're always welcome to work more hours than the minimum, but it isn't required or expected.

4) So what are the minimum number of hours that I'll have to work?

16 hours for most positions, but some positions may require more.

5) Will I be able to cosplay?

Absolutely. We do ask that you not wear a mask or carry weapons while you're on-duty, but otherwise the sky's the limit. You probably also want to avoid bulky or hard-to-get-around-in costumes, but they're not forbidden. It's just that you'll frequently want to get from point A to point B in a hurry, and bulky costumes make that difficult.

7) I've heard that you have monthly staff meetings. Do I have to attend them in order to be staff?

Usually not. However, certain positions may require certain meetings for training or planning purposes, so check when you apply for staff if you think you might have trouble attending meetings. That said, it's good to come if you can - staff meetings are a great chance to get to know and spend time with your fellow staffers, learn more about how the convention is run, and get more involved.

8) If I join, how long of a commitment are we talking about?

Staff positions last for one convention year. This does mean you have to re-apply every year... but that itself is a benefit in some ways, because it offers the chance to try different departments and/or positions.

9) Sounds good so far. How do I get signed up?

Come to one of our staff meetings! (https://www.kumoricon.org/meetings) Once the "official" part of the meeting is over and we go into breakouts, you'll need to approach the Director of the department you'd be working with. You can find out who your Director would be from the positions chart, and you can tell who's who because they each give a report during the official part of the meeting. He or she can tell you about the position, and/or might point you to the manager of your specific area to find out more.

You'll also need to fill out a staff form. You can print one out ahead of time and fill it out, or you can always just grab one at the meeting - we'll have them there as well. You'll need the Director of your department to initial off on your form to show that you've been approved, then you bring it to the Secretary to register.

Here's a fun question: Now that Kumoricon is four days instead of three, how many hours will most staff be required to work? Will it be an increase from the old standby of 16 hours over the course of con or will it remain the same?

There is a rule that underlies all the staff positions that any position must require no less than 16 hours of work. That rule hasn't officially changed. However, every staff position has its own time and area requirements, which may exceed 16 hours or specify certain tasks, responsibilities, or locations. These may in some cases increase.
